Identifying Your Yoga Goals

Before you start searching, identify what you want from your yoga journey. Are you pursuing physical fitness, stress relief, spiritual growth, or a blend of these aims? Your goals will chart the course for choosing your ideal instructor.

As you reflect, consider the specific branches of yoga that resonate with you. Whether it’s the intensity of poses in Ashtanga, the precision of Iyengar, the flow of Vinyasa, or the mindfulness of Yin, each style has unique benefits that align with different objectives.

Remember, your aspirations can evolve over time. A flexible mindset allows you to adjust and optimize your search for an online yoga instructor who can support your ever-changing wellness path.

Tailoring Your Search for Specialties

When seeking out an online yoga instructor, pinpointing one’s specialty can significantly enhance your practice. Look for those who cater to your specific style or interest.

Bear in mind that certain practices like Therapeutic Yoga or Prenatal Yoga require specialized expertise. An instructor with certifications and the proper training in these areas can offer tailored guidance, ensuring a safe and effective practice.

Adapting your search to include considerations such as experience, alignment with personal health needs, and specialized training can lead to better outcomes. Look for teachers who have E-RYT 200 or E-RYT 500 training from Yoga Alliance. A specialized yoga instructor with the right training can offer deep insights and tailored programs to help you flourish in your dedicated practice space.

Assessing Potential Instructors

When exploring potential instructors online, consider their Yoga Alliance certifications, teaching experience, and alignment with your yoga philosophy. Authenticity matters; therefore, seek out those with a palpable passion for yoga and evidence of continuous learning and practice. An instructor’s specialization can greatly enhance your journey, whether you’re drawn to Vinyasa, Hatha, or therapeutic yoga disciplines.

Evaluate the instructor’s communication style through their online content and student testimonials. Effective instructors foster a welcoming space for growth and provide guidance tailored to individual capabilities, making the selection of the right mentor a pivotal step in your yoga practice.

Reading Reviews and Testimonials

Absorbing the experiences of others offers invaluable insights into an instructor’s effectiveness and compatibility with your needs.

  • Investigate overall ratings to gauge general satisfaction.
  • Scrutinize specific comments for experiences that mirror your own objectives.
  • Pay attention to recurring themes, such as adaptability or communication skills.
  • Notice the frequency of reviews to assess the instructor’s current engagement and relevance.
  • Evaluate the responses from instructors to reviews, reflecting their interaction and attentiveness to students.

Reviews often unveil the nuances of an instructor’s style, something not always evident through a general profile or description.

Testimonials can bridge the gap between uncertainty and confidence in your choice, catalyzing a more informed decision-making process.
